About Pansemal Tehsil

Pansemal is a tehsil in district of Barwani , Madhya Pradesh , India. As per the data provided by Census of India in 2011, total population of Pansemal was 157,975 which includes 79,542 males and 78,433 females. Pansemal covers 676 Km2 area.

Urban/Rural Population of Pansemal

DESCRIPTION VALUE DESCRIPTION VALUE
Urban Population 27,910 Rural Population 130,065
Urban male Population 14,337 Rural Male Population 65,205
Urban Female Population 13,573 Rural Female Population 64,860

This table provides a detailed breakdown of the urban and rural population of Pansemal. The Pansemal urban population is 27,910 with 14,337 male population and 13,573 female population. In contrast Pansemal rural population is 130,065, comprising 65,205 male population and 64,860 female population. A tehsil is the administrative level between a district and a village. Depending on the state it may be called a taluka, mandal, block or circle.
